  3. If you are going to the Orlando area, Mears Shuttle will take you there at a good rate versus a limo service. If you are staying on Disney property, the Disney Magical Express will take you for free (run by Mears) and even deliver your luggage to your room all free!
  4. If you are staying at a Disney hotel free shuttle available from airport. Public bus $2 and will take a good while http://golynx.com Shuttle about $20 per person http://www.mearstransportation.com/ Taxi $65 http://orlandosanfordtaxi.com
